Preparing for your telehealth appointment

Counseling is an interpersonal process that has traditionally been face to face. The use of electronic means such as telephone or video challenges the counseling process by reducing the non-verbal cues between the therapist and the client, changing the meaning and interpretation of pauses, and eliminating the environmental controls of the therapist’s office. Thus, special attention must be given in order to assure your maximum benefit from your telehealth session. Please be sure to review the informed consent form.

In preparation foe each appointment, please be sure you are in a safe and private place with as few distractions as possible. It would be helpful if you have an idea of things you want to address, an agenda. You may want to articulate for yourself and for your therapist an idea of what you would like to leave the session with. Subsequent to the session you can ask yourself, as a result of my conversation today, what will change in my feelings, my behavior, my life today.
